Thailand: Honda in hot water for unfair trading practices

 |  January 11, 2013

The Trade Competition Commission met last week to ask the Office of the Attorney General to indict AP Honda for antitrust violations, according to a statement from Commerce Minister Boonsong Teriyapirom. Honda is accused of violating the Competition Trade Act of 1999 with regards to its practice of prohibiting motorcycle dealers from selling competing brands, a finding of the Commission’s investigation into the matter. The statute of limitations expires in April and the Office of the Attorney General will decide whether or not to pursue a legal case against Honda.
